Chick-fil-A customer orders a burger and thinks she’s at McDonald’s

A Chick-fil-A employee claimed that a customer insisted on buying a hamburger from Chick-fil-A, thinking she was at McDonald’s.

The video featured TikTok user Lexi (@lexbreezy5) sitting in her car, providing background on how she “worked at Chick-fil-A on and off for six years” because she’s a student in college and past Didn’t work there one year on vacation.

“A lot has changed, but there are things that haven’t changed, and the things that haven’t changed are the people who show up in our drive-thru and act like fools,” she says. Then she dived into the story about the incident with the customer.

The incident happened outside at the drive-thru, Lexi says. Because one of the contractors needed to use the bathroom, Lexi says she jumped in to cover for them, and then it went downhill.

When she gets to a car to take her order, Lexi claims the customer “looked dead to her” and asked for a hamburger. Perplexed, Lexi says she explained to the customer that Chick-fil-A doesn’t sell hamburgers, only chicken sandwiches. This allegedly confused the customer.

“‘What kind of McDonald’s doesn’t have hamburgers?'” Lexi recalls when asked by the woman, which led to back and forth since the customer was convinced she was at McDonald’s. Even after showing the customer her uniform, Lexi says the lady wasn’t convinced.

moral of the story? “You all have to be more careful,” Lexi concludes in the video.

During an interview with The Daily Dot via TikTok direct message, Lexi shared that this incident took place at a Chick-fil-A in Mississippi’s Jackson Metro Area. She said she dealt with crazy customers, but not the ones in the video.

The conversation lasted about three to four minutes, Lexi said, as the lady was “completely fixated on the fact that she was at McDonald’s.” Lexi shared that this could be because the lady was “high on weed.”

“It was the first thing I smelled when she rolled down her window,” Lexi told the Daily Dot.

The video was viewed 1.5 million times as of Saturday, and alleged Chick-fil-A employees shared their crazy customer experiences in the comments.

“I also work at cfa. One day a lady argued with me and said that a chicken strip and a chicken breast fillet are not the same thing,” one viewer wrote.

“When I was working at CFA, a guy came in with his Taco Bell bag and complained to me that his taco was fake,” wrote a second.

“People coming through cfa scare me sometimes,” wrote another TikToker. “I had a guy ask for frog legs. His wife said he was joking, but I think he meant it.”
